Something like >> >> # filesys mount point type access dump fsck >> # location + opts freq pass >> >> /dev/vinum/myvol /mnt/large ffs rw 1 2 >> >> should do it. Unless maybe this tries to mount it too early in the boot >> sequence. In that case, make it >> >> /dev/vinum/myvol /mnt/large ffs rw,noauto 1 2 >> >> so that the initial mount -a will not try to mount it yet, and put the >> following in /etc/rc.local: >> >> mount /mnt/large >> >> -Olaf (none of this is vinum-sprecific, by te way). > > Thanx for your reply. However, it didn't quite fix it; (after booting) > > bash-2.02# mount /mnt/large > mount: exec mount_ffs not found in /sbin, /usr/sbin: No such file or directory > > if I change the type field in /etc/fstab to 'ufs' instead of 'ffs', I > get a filesystemcheck error; /dev/vinum/rmyvol: device not configured > > this is probably coz at that time, vinum hasn't started yet. Correct. You should set start_vinum in your rc.conf. > for completeness, the line from fstab: > > /dev/vinum/myvol /mnt/large ufs rw,noauto 1 2 Was that a complete statement?
